Binary search using while loop java

WebWatch out for the exact wording in the problems -- a "binary search tree" is different from a "binary tree". The nodes at the bottom edge of the tree have empty subtrees and are called "leaf" nodes (1, 4, 6) while the others are … W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've narrowed down the possible locations to just one. We used binary search in the guessing game in the introductory tutorial.

binary search on c, the while loop - Stack Overflow

WebFollowing is a simple stack-based iterative algorithm to perform inorder traversal: iterativeInorder (node) s —> empty stack while (not s.isEmpty () or node != null) if (node != null) s.push (node) node —> node.left else node —> s.pop () visit (node) node —> node.right The algorithm can be implemented as follows in C++, Java, and Python: C++ … WebBinary Search Implementation using Java Let's write a source code for binary search in Java. There are many ways we can write logic for binary search: Iterative implementation Recursive Implementation Using Arrays.binarySearch () Using Collections.binarySearch () Iterative Implementation how much protein shake per day https://platinum-ifa.com

Java Program to search ArrayList Element using Binary Search

WebApr 19, 2024 · A binary search java is a searching technique to search the element from the given set of data. For binary search, data must be in sorted order. In this method, a … WebThe following is our sorted array and let us assume that we need to search the location of value 10 using binary search. First, we shall determine half of the array by using this … WebApr 10, 2024 · Algorithm. Step 1 − Start. Step 2 − Sort an array following an ascending order. Step 3 − Set low index to the first element. Step 4 − Set high index to the last … how much protein should a ckd patient eat

Binary Search in Java – Algorithm Example - FreeCodecamp

Category:Data Structures 101: Binary Search Tree - FreeCodecamp

Tags:Binary search using while loop java

Binary search using while loop java

Implementing Binary Search in Python - Python Pool

http://cslibrary.stanford.edu/110/BinaryTrees.html WebApr 24, 2016 · Searching Binary Tree with a While loop. I am trying to write a function that searches for a value on a tree I built, I have written a recursive function that works fine. …

Binary search using while loop java

Did you know?

Web1. cooding program binary search pada visual basic studio; 2. Buatlah program C++ dengan mengunakan Sequential search dan binary search secara descending. Web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this approach, the element is always searched in the middle of a portion of an array. Binary search can be implemented only …

WebMay 13, 2024 · Thus, the running time of binary search is described by the recursive function T ( n) = T ( n 2) + α. Solving the equation above gives us that T ( n) = α log 2 ( n). Choosing constants c = α and n 0 = 1, you can … WebApr 10, 2024 · Algorithm. Step 1 − Start. Step 2 − Sort an array following an ascending order. Step 3 − Set low index to the first element. Step 4 − Set high index to the last element. Step 5 − With low or high indication set average of the middle index. Step 6 − If the targeted element is in middle. Return middle.

WebWe have created a function called binary_search () function which takes two arguments - a list to sorted and a number to be searched. We have declared two variables to store the lowest and highest values in the list. The low is assigned initial value to 0, high to len (list1) - 1 and mid as 0. WebJava allows 'recursive' methods - that is, a method can call itself - and binary chops are a classic case where it makes a lot of sense to do so. However, before that: have you …

WebExample: Java Program to Implement Binary Search Algorithm. Here, we have used the Java Scanner Class to take input from the user. Based on the input from user, we used the binary search to check if the element is present in the array. We can also use the …

WebJan 2, 2024 · Hi, in this tutorial, we are going to write a program to which shows an example to implement Binary Search Algorithm on Sorted List using Loop in Python. Define Binary Search Function So, lets’ s create a new function named Binary Search which accepts two parameters as arguments, first is the target element which we want to … how do people apply and receive jsaWebFeb 9, 2024 · There are two ways to do a binary search in Java Arrays.binarysearch Collections.binarysearch Type 1: Arrays.binarysearch () It works for arrays which can be … how do people and animals cause weatheringWebMar 4, 2024 · Binary Search (sometimes known as Logarithmic Search) is a widely popular algorithm to search a sorted array for the position of a given element. It works on a divide and conquer basis by comparing the target element with the middle element of the array. how much protein should a 16 year old consumeWebThe following steps are followed to search for an element k = 1 in the list below. Array to be searched for Start from the first element, compare k with each element x . Compare with each element If x == k, return the index. Element found Else, return not found. Linear Search Algorithm how do people and goods get around in hawaiihow do people alter the ph of sea waterWebBinary search via iteration Suppose we want to find an element in a sorted array. from left to right: we can use binary search. Here is the binary search algorithm, written as a loop. binary_search.java Conceptually, this algorithm is simple. How do we know we got the computation of mright? Why is it k <= a[m]and not k < a[m]? how do people assess the earthquake hazardsWebSet m (the position of the middle element) to the floor (the largest previous integer) of (L + R) / 2. If Am < T, set L to m + 1 and go to step 2. If Am > T, set R to m − 1 and go to step … how do people beam on roblox